'My Idea Guy'

Another affiliate marketing guy known for his ideas is Stu McLaren. He comes up with ideas which can generate income. He has his developed methods and solutions. He also shared this with others through his 'My Idea Guy' blog. He even used courses of known affiliate marketers and proved the results are true.

As fas as I know, he is the trainer and affiliate manager who's expert at generating traffic, traffic and more traffic. For me, he also writes very good, very imaginative and not boring at all. He explains his ideas well.

He also teamed up with Russell Brunson for their Affiliate Inferno program which teaches how to have a profitable affiliate program. Secrets of real, successful business owners are revealed through learning how they leverage on people's money and websites.
